#574725 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#574725 is composed of 34.1% red, 27.8%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.4% magenta, 57.5%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 40.8 degrees, a saturation of 40.3% and a lightness of 24.3%. #574725 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ae8e4a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#574725 color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#574725 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#574725 has RGB values of R:87, G:71,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.57,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5719845.
